Start With Reach, Not Just Pump Size
If you are trying to figure out what size boom pump do I need for a pool deck, the real starting point is reach, not the nameplate on the truck. A pool deck pour can look small on paper and still be awkward in the field if the truck cannot get close, the hose needs to clear landscaping, or the pour has to wrap around a house, retaining wall, or existing pool shell.
In most residential settings, the practical answer comes down to how far the pump has to place concrete from the truck setup point to the farthest part of the deck. If the truck can stage close to the work, a smaller boom may be enough. If access is tight, the job may call for a larger boom or a different setup altogether.
A practical rule is to choose the smallest boom that can cover the whole deck with a little room left over. That buffer matters because the operator needs room to move, place concrete cleanly, and avoid putting the truck in a bad angle. For many pool decks, a 24 m to 38 m boom is common, but the right choice depends on the site, not just the square footage.

What The Truck Can Actually Do
Boom size is usually discussed in meters, but what matters to a homeowner or builder is how that reach translates on site. A 24 m boom is often a fit for shorter residential placements where the truck can get relatively close. A 32 m or 38 m boom gives more reach and more placement flexibility when the truck cannot get in tight. Very large pumps are usually more truck than a standard pool deck needs, unless the site is unusually restricted.
There is a catch, though, because maximum reach is not the same as useful reach. A pump may be rated for a long reach, but the operator still needs stable ground, a safe setup, and a workable boom angle. If the truck has to sit on a slope, straddle a curb, or work around soft turf, the usable reach may be less than the brochure number suggests.
For pool decks, the shape of the pour matters almost as much as the distance. A straight side run is easier than a deck that wraps around corners, changes elevation, or connects to multiple outdoor features. The more the pour changes direction, the more useful a highly articulated boom becomes.
Choosing The Right Setup
For a lot of residential work, the choice is not only boom size, it is also whether a boom pump or a line pump is the better tool. A boom pump places concrete with a hydraulic arm, which is ideal when the truck can set up nearby and the pour needs speed, control, and fewer workers on the hose. A line pump sends concrete through hose from a stationary truck, which can work better on tight lots, backyards, or sites with difficult access.
For a typical pool deck, a boom pump is often the cleaner option if the truck can park within reach and the pour is large enough to justify the setup. It cuts down on labor, speeds placement, and helps keep concrete moving before it starts to set up. That said, a line pump can be the better answer when the property has a narrow access lane, a gated courtyard, or a backyard that a boom truck cannot safely reach.

A larger boom can save time, but it may be overkill if the site is open and the deck is not complicated. On the other hand, using a line pump on a pour that really wants a boom can slow the crew and create extra handling around forms, steel, and finishing.
What The Truck Needs Before It Rolls
The best way to size a boom pump is to work backward from the site access, not forward from the equipment catalog. Contractors should identify the staging spot, the hose path, and any obstacles like walls, trees, or existing structures. That is especially true on older homes and estate properties where the driveway was never designed for modern pump trucks.
A few questions usually settle the issue quickly:
- Can the truck stage close enough without creating problems for the crew or the property? Will the boom need to reach over the house, pool, fence, or retaining wall? Is there a safe, level place for outriggers and truck setup? Will the pour be continuous, or will the hose need to be repositioned several times?
Those details matter because concrete waits for no one. A pool deck is often an exposed decorative surface, so delays, cold joints, or rough hose handling become visible later. Good planning keeps placement smooth and gives the finisher a much better chance at a clean result.

Cost, Timing, And Common Mistakes
Once the size question is settled, cost becomes the next practical concern. How much does concrete pumping cost in Greenwich CT depends on boom size, hose length, access conditions, volume, and how long the crew needs the pump on site. A simple driveway placement is usually cheaper to manage than a backyard deck that requires careful maneuvering and several hose moves.
The most common mistake is choosing a pump that is too small just to save a bit up front. If the boom is undersized, the crew may waste time repositioning, the hose may need to be dragged farther than planned, and the pour can become more stressful than necessary. A second mistake is ignoring setup requirements like ground bearing, overhead clearance, and the space needed for outriggers. Those are the details that decide whether a truck can work efficiently or has to be backed out and replaced with a different solution.
If you are comparing concrete pumping vs concrete truck chute delivery, the answer on a pool deck usually favors pumping once the truck cannot dump directly beside the forms. Chutes work fine when access is open and the pour is shallow, but they stop being practical fast when the site tightens up or the grade changes. For larger or more complex jobs, the speed and control of pumping often justify the added equipment cost.
